    Vicky Kaushal Reveals The One Film He Wants His Baby Boy to Watch First

    Actor Vicky Kaushal is soaking in the joys of fatherhood after welcoming his baby boy with wife Katrina Kaif earlier this year. Amid this new phase of life, the actor has chosen a special film from his career that he hopes to share with his son when the time is right.
    Speaking to NDTV in an interview, actor Vicky Kaushal opened up about fatherhood and reflected on his journey so far, both personally and professionally. When asked which of his films he would want his son to watch first, Vicky didn’t hesitate.
    He revealed that his choice would be Masaan, his debut film. Calling it “a nice film,” Vicky admitted that it might not be suitable for very early viewing, given its emotional weight. However, he added that the film captures life in its rawest and most truthful form, making it deeply meaningful to him. Directed by Neeraj Ghaywan, Masaan marked Vicky’s first leading role. The film showcased him as Deepak Kumar, a young engineering student working at the cremation ghats of Varanasi. The film explored themes of death, loss, social stigma, and resilience, and went on to become a critical landmark in his career.
    Vicky also spoke candidly about raising a child in the public eye and whether he worries about his son’s privacy. He explained that he tries not to live in fear, believing that excessive worry only attracts the very things one wants to avoid. Instead, he and Katrina are consciously protective of their personal space, treating it as something sacred and worth guarding, even while accepting that occasional slips are inevitable in public life.
    The actor and Katrina Kaif announced the birth of their son in November with a heartfelt note expressing love and gratitude. Married since December 2021, the couple has largely kept their family life away from the spotlight.


    On the work front, Vicky had a stellar 2025 with Chhaava, which emerged as one of the highest-grossing Indian films of the year, earning over ₹800 crore worldwide. He will next be seen in Sanjay Leela Bhansali’s Love & War. Joining him are Ranbir Kapoor and Alia Bhatt for this wartime drama.
